Beginning of ReadMe : VI/87 Planetary Ephemerides (Chapront+ 1996) ================================================================================ Ephemerides of planets between 1900 and 2100 (1998 update) Chapront J., Francou G. <Bureau des Longitudes, Group : Dynamics of Solar System (1996)> ================================================================================ ADC_Keywords: Ephemerides ; Planets Keywords: planets - ephemerides - celestial mechanics Description: Planetary motions have been represented with series resulting of an approximation by frequency analysis of JPL numerical integration DE403. Series represent the heliocentric coordinates of planets as functions of time between 1900 and 2100 for the 9 bodies : Mercury, Venus, Earth-Moon Barycenter, Mars, Jupiter, Saturn, Uranus, Neptune and Pluto. The method allows to compute planetary ephemerides with the aid of compact tables and keeps accuracy of published ephemerides. Authors' Addresses: J. Francou, Observatoire de Paris Institut de mecanique celeste et de calcul des ephemerides 77, avenue Denfert-Rochereau - F75014 PARIS E-mail : Contents: The presentation of the series is given in file series96.doc. The planetary series are in files series96.xxx (one file per planet). A Fortran subroutine series96.sub (96.12) uses the series for computing the heliocentric rectangular coordinates of planets. A Fortran program series96.f is provided to illustrate the use of the series in the case of the computation of astrometric coordinates. An executable DOS program, planeph.exe, allows to compute the most usual planetary ephemerides with the series between 1900 to 2100. The file planeph.doc gives explanations for using this program with the data sets planeph.tab and planeph.loc.
